| Method | Steps summary | Estimated time | Proof obtained | Difficulty |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| App (no-contract / Stripe) | Log in > Account > Your Membership > tap 'Active Membership' > press 'Cancel'. Must be done at least 24 hours before the next payment. | 5-10 minutes | In-app confirmation screenshot | Easy |
| Direct Debit (bank) | Cancel the Direct Debit with your bank. DD shows as 'DFC (Debit Finance Collections)' on statement. Cannot be cancelled before the first payment. | 10-30 minutes with bank | Bank cancellation reference | Medium |
| PayPal recurring | Cancel the recurring payment in PayPal. Give at least 10 days notice after minimum term or where PayPal is the recurring method. | 5-15 minutes | PayPal cancellation screenshot | Easy |
| Email / Written | 24/7 Gym states verbal, written or emailed notifications are not accepted by 24/7 Fitness, the Centre, or Debit Finance Collections PLC. | Not accepted | None accepted by company | Hard |
| Post (registered letter) | 24/7 Gym provides a postal address but their policy states written notifications are not accepted; method may not stop billing unless bank/PayPal cancelled. | Not accepted as primary method | Receipt of postage only | Hard |
If you must move and the new address makes attendance impossible, present proof of relocation such as a new tenancy agreement or utility bill. 24/7 Gym's published materials do not list specific moving exceptions; you should raise the request in your member account and support channels and keep documentation.
Applicable law: Consumer Rights Act 2015 - unfair contract terms may be challenged if the contract refuses reasonable exit options following significant relocation.
If the membership price increases and you want to cancel because of that increase, check your contract for a price increase clause. If the increase is not permitted under your signed contract, you have grounds to refuse further payments and to complain. Citizens Advice explains rights where a unilateral price increase allows contract termination: see Citizens Advice.
Applicable law: Consumer Rights Act 2015.
To cancel a membership after the death of the subscriber, supply the death certificate and proof of executor or next of kin. 24/7 Gym does not publish a specific process in the publicly available material, so send documentation to the support email and keep copies.
Applicable law: Contract law principles under the Consumer Rights Act 2015 where performance is no longer possible.
Citizens Advice notes serious injury or illness can allow contract termination with notice; submit medical evidence such as a doctor letter and a written request. 24/7 Gym accepts exceptional circumstances for Paid in Full refunds only under a specified formula; for other memberships present medical evidence to the club and keep proof.
Applicable law: Consumer Rights Act 2015.
If your membership has a fixed minimum term (for example 12 months), you can stop payments when that term expires, following the contract's stated end date. For Paid in Full annual packages the term is explicit: 3 months for £95, 6 months for £175, 12 months for £330 (Torpoint examples).
Applicable law: Consumer Contracts Regulations 2013 and Contract terms governed by the Consumer Rights Act 2015.
If you bought online or off-premises you may have a 14-day cooling-off right under the Consumer Contracts Regulations 2013. Digital content exception applies if you consented to immediate access. For other purchases consult Citizens Advice.
Applicable law: Consumer Contracts Regulations 2013.

Services must be performed with reasonable care and skill under the Consumer Rights Act 2015. If a term is unfair, it may not be binding on the consumer. The Consumer Contracts Regulations 2013 provide a 14-day cooling-off right for contracts concluded online or off-premises, subject to digital content exceptions.
The Competition and Markets Authority treats hard-to-cancel subscriptions and unclear auto-renewal terms as potentially unfair. If you face obstacles cancelling, document the steps you took and the dates.
Step 1: Complain to 24/7 Gym via the app/account and keep all proof. Step 2: Seek help from Citizens Advice: Citizens Advice - cancelling a gym membership. Step 3: If payment was by credit card and the payment qualifies, consider a Section 75 claim or a chargeback through your card issuer. Use Companies House to confirm company details if needed: Company details.
After cancellation, verify you retain or lose access according to your contract. Check bank statements for any unexpected charges and confirm that future Direct Debit payments have been stopped. If a payment posts after cancellation, contact your bank immediately and use chargeback if eligible.
Keep screenshots of the cancellation confirmation, bank or PayPal cancellation receipts, and any correspondence. If you used Direct Debit cancellation, keep the bank cancellation reference. Request deletion or retention of your personal data via the support email if required.
